    Lewis (Kasi) McAllister of Detroit, Michigan, former baseball player was a one-time big leaguer who broke into organized baseball with the Fort Worth Club of the Texas League back in 1895. This is McAllister's first visit to Fort Worth since 1928. He is visiting his sister, Mrs. William Boardman and his brother L.B . McAllister. Mr. McAlister is shown turning the knob on a radio. Published Fort Worth Star-Telegram Morning Edition October 5, 1944.
